    sight glass



    Why would it be wrong to fit to fit a sight glass befor the drier

    Regards bernard

    Re: sight glass

    Hi Bernard,
    I cant think of a purely technical answer but perhaps its so there is then no possible restriction of liquid from then on till the evaperator. Obvioulsly if the drier was blocked and the sightglass was before it the then drier could show liquid in it but because of a blocked drier the liquid would not get to the coil.

    Re: sight glass

    Hi Bernard,

    Sight glass should show the flow and if equipped, also if the liquid is wet or dry.

    It is installed after the drier in case the drier is partially blocked,
    Then you see the white bubbles but to make sure drier doe's not function right, feel it, if cold = blocked, if warm = sortage of gas.
